How To Report Fraud
It's not always easy to spot a scam, and new ones are invented every day.
If you suspect that you may be a target of fraud, or if you have already sent funds, don't be embarrassed - you're not alone.
If you want to report a fraud, or if you need more information, contact The Canadian Anti- Fraud Centre:
Ways to report fraud •On-line: https://www.antifraudcentre-centreantifraude.ca •Toll Free: 1-+1 888-495-8501 •Toll Free Fax: 1-+1 888-654-9426 •Email: info @ antifraudcentre.ca

It's not their fault
Hi guys, I just want to clear a few things up for you annoyed people. 1) If a company calls to do a SURVEY, then the DO NOT CALL LIST DOESN'T APPLY (look it up if you don't believe me, survey companies are exempt)2) If the company calls you and you hang up, they WILL call you back because it's an automated dialer and they have NO control as to how many times you get called a day. That's what automated dialers do.3) It's not the people conducting the surveys fault that you get called, it's the company they are doing the survey for, so no need to be rude to them. They're doing their job, so talk to the company whose PAYING them to do the survey4) It's not a scam, listen to what they say before you cut them off, if they ask for personal information then don't answer the question, but I've taken the call and they don't ask personal questions5) THEY CANNOT REVEAL WHO THE SURVEY IS FOR UNLESS THEY ARE SPEAKING TO THE PERSON ON FILE. (This is for the privacy of the individual, you don't know how many times husbands and wives actually find out their spouse has a secret account, so if the person reveals who the survey is for, it could cause for more problems). This has happened numerous times, so they're doing it to protect the client. 6) Like I said before, it is NOT THEIR FAULT for calling you, it is the company paying them to do the survey, no need to be rude to them, (unless they are rude to you) but hear them out before you hang up or else they will put you down for a call backPS. If they don't answer right away, it's because they are using an automated dialer so it takes a while for them to hear you, so again, that isn't their fault. Just kindly asked to be put on THEIR OWN do not call list, and they should happily oblige.
